Safety Assessment of Hyunburikyung-tang for Dysmenorrhea

In recent years, there has been a notable resurgence of interest in traditional forms of medicine, particularly within the realm of complementary therapies. Among these is Hyunburikyung-tang, a traditional Korean medicine that has been utilized for various ailments, including dysmenorrhea. A groundbreaking study led by Jo, Sy. et al., published in “BMC Complementary Medicine and Therapies,” dives deep into the genotoxicity and acute toxicity of this herbal formulation, shedding light on the implications of its use in modern medical practices.

The study, which is anticipated to pave the way for more comprehensive understanding and acceptance of traditional treatments in contemporary medicine, evaluates the safety profile of Hyunburikyung-tang. As alternative therapies gain traction, understanding their genetic impact and toxicity becomes essential. Jo and colleagues conducted a rigorous investigation to assess the potential risks associated with this herbal medicine.

Dysmenorrhea, or painful menstruation, significantly affects the quality of life for many individuals. Traditional Korean medicine, among other holistic practices, often proposes herbal formulations such as Hyunburikyung-tang to alleviate this distressing condition. However, concerns surrounding the safety and efficacy of such treatments persist, necessitating scholarly attention. The research emerges at a critical junction where traditional practices are being scrutinized through modern scientific methodologies.

The study’s methodology involved a series of in vitro and in vivo experiments designed to evaluate both genotoxic and acute toxic effects. By rigorously applying scientific processes, the researchers aimed to provide an evidence-based perspective on the traditional remedy’s safety. Such an approach is especially vital as it bridges the gap between ancient practices and contemporary medical standards, potentially enhancing patient care through informed decision-making.

One of the primary findings from the researchers is the lack of significant genotoxic effects associated with Hyunburikyung-tang. This is particularly encouraging for practitioners who aspire to integrate these traditional remedies into their repertoire. Genotoxicity is a critical concern when prescribing any medicinal formulation, as it relates directly to the potential for damaging an individual’s DNA.

Additionally, the acute toxicity results demonstrated a favorable safety profile, reinforcing the legitimacy of further clinical investigations. Acute toxicity refers to the adverse effects that occur shortly after a single dose of a substance. Understanding this aspect allows for a more nuanced perspective on the short-term risks involved in using Hyunburikyung-tang. Such data is imperative not only for healthcare providers but also for patients who are looking for safe alternatives to manage their symptoms.

While the study presents preliminary evidence supporting Hyunburikyung-tang as a safe option for treating dysmenorrhea, it also urges a cautious approach. The authors emphasize the need for larger clinical trials to substantiate these findings further. Medical practitioners are encouraged to remain grounded in scientific evidence, especially when dealing with herbal medicines, which might have varying effects on different individuals.
